Sealing Sleeve Systems

  • Used only for a below the knee prosthesis, sealing sleeve systems often are paired with a gel cushion liner (no locking pin) which is applied to the body in the same manner as a pin locking liner.
  • With the limb placed in the socket, a sealing sleeve is applied over the outer upper portion of the socket and pulled up onto the thigh creating a seal against the skin.
  • A one way expulsion valve is normally integrated at the base of the socket to allow air to expel creating a form of suction suspension. The valve is removed to ease taking the prosthesis off.
